“The two most beautiful words in the English language are ‘check enclosed’.”
~Dorothy Parker

“There was a time when a fool and his money were soon parted, but now it happens to everybody.”
~Adlai Stevenson

“Annual income twenty pounds, annual expenditure nineteen ninety-six, result happiness. Annual income twenty pounds, annual expenditure twenty pounds ought and six, result misery.”
~Charles Dickens
